Cancelling a paid order

Cancel an order the customer has already paid for. Crate removes it from your sales totals and walks you through restocking and refunding — money never moves automatically, so you stay in control.

Sometimes a customer pays and then changes their mind, or you discover you can't fulfil the order. Cancelling a paid order is different from cancelling an unpaid one — the order already took money, so Crate keeps the record for your books while removing it from your live sales figures.

Cancel vs. delete vs. refund

These three actions do different things, and it's worth knowing which you need:

  • Cancel keeps the order on file but pulls it out of your sales totals. Use it when the sale is off but you still want the paper trail.
  • Delete wipes the order completely — and Crate only allows it for unpaid orders. A paid order can never be deleted.
  • Refund returns money to the customer. Cancelling does not move money on its own.

Money doesn't move automatically

When you cancel a paid order, Crate adjusts your reporting but never touches the customer's money for you. If the buyer is owed a refund, send it from the order's Refund action, or return it through whatever channel they paid with. This keeps you in full control of every naira that leaves your account.

Tip: Tick Restock the items on the cancel screen so the stock you'd reserved goes straight back into your available inventory — otherwise those units stay tied up.

  1. 1
    Open the paid order

    From Orders, open the order you need to cancel. A paid order shows a green Paid badge at the top.

  2. 2
    Choose Cancel order

    In the Order actions card near the bottom of the order, click Cancel order. Cancel is different from delete — it keeps the record but takes it out of your sales.

  3. 3
    Read the paid-order notice

    Because this order was paid, Crate shows a reminder that cancelling removes the amount from total sales but does not return the money. You refund the customer separately.

  4. 4
    Pick a reason and confirm

    Choose a cancellation reason, decide whether to restock the items and notify the customer, then click Cancel order.

  5. 5
    Order marked cancelled

    Crate confirms the cancellation and the order moves to the Cancelled tab. Its value no longer counts toward your sales.
